Skill Quick Reference

Situation Skill One-liner
Starting a session /check-env Verify ports, Docker, env vars, credentials
Need to think through options /brainstorming Multi-perspective idea exploration
About to write complex code /karpathy-guidelines Anti-overcomplication checklist
Planning a large feature /writing-plans Structured implementation plan
Ready to execute a plan /executing-plans Batch execution with checkpoints
Writing new functionality /test-first TDD: tests before implementation
Cleaning up code /refactor Zero-behavior-change refactoring
Running database changes /migrate-db Safe migration with rollback plan
Want to understand code /explain Layered explanation (simple to deep)
Exploring a codebase /deep-explore Multi-file structural analysis
Finding patterns across repos /cross-project-search Search across all repositories
Reviewing my changes /code-review Structured review with severity ratings
Reviewing open PRs /pr-batch-review Batch review of all open PRs
Checking for vulnerabilities /security-check OWASP Top 10 quick scan
Auditing dependencies /dependency-audit Vulnerability and update audit
Generating release notes /changelog Changelog from recent commits
Deploying to production /deploy Safe deployment with OOM prevention
Wrapping up a session /handoff Structured session summary
Learning from corrections /autoskill Extract patterns from session history
Creating new skills /skill-creator Meta-skill for building skills
Before pushing code /codex-prepush-review Automated code review

Common Combinations

These skill sequences work well together:

Workflow Sequence When
New feature /check-env/brainstorming/writing-plans/test-first/code-review/deploy Building something new
Bug fix /check-env → fix → /code-review/deploy Fixing a production issue
Tech debt /deep-explore/refactor/code-review Cleaning up old code
Release /security-check/dependency-audit/changelog/deploy Cutting a release
Onboarding /explain/deep-explore/cross-project-search Understanding a new codebase
End of day /code-review/handoff Wrapping up work
